It is a great experience and a must do for someone...... more » Owner description: We offer a Half day cooking classes for visitors to Nha Trang at a cost of $24 USD per person. It is a great experience and a must do for someone looking for variety to their trip to Nha Trang and something a little different. It involves travelling to the local market in a cyclo, a guided tour of the marketplace, where people get involved in learning about the local food and buying the ingredients for your meals. You then return to the restaurant where you prepare 3 dishes as chosen by the guests and of course enjoy eating what you have prepared. « less
